Preparing for the Consortium of Medical, Engineering and Dental Colleges of Karnataka (COMEDK) UGET does not necessitate expensive, high-pressure coaching institutes. Official exam data and topper retrospectives indicate that the exam primarily tests speed, accuracy, and fundamental conceptual clarity aligned closely with standard Class 11 and Class 12 curricula (CBSE/State boards). Unlike JEE Advanced, COMEDK features 180 questions to be solved in 180 minutes with zero negative marking, rewarding time management over deep theoretical derivation.
Opting for a self-study approach empowers aspirants to customize their daily timetables, eliminate commute fatigue, and focus intensely on high-weightage topics. Furthermore, under the updated COMEDK eligibility criteria, Chemistry is no longer compulsory as the mandatory fourth subject, giving students greater flexibility in aligning their core strengths with the exam framework. By leveraging standard textbooks, online test series, and disciplined revision cycles, self-taught candidates frequently secure seats in premier institutions like RV College of Engineering, BMS College of Engineering, and MS Ramaiah Institute of Technology.

Structuring a 3-month self-study plan requires dividing preparation into foundational concept building, rigorous practice, and full-length mock simulation. According to official examination prospectuses and academic guidelines, candidates must prioritize high-yielding chapters across Mathematics, Physics, and Chemistry. Month one should focus entirely on completing NCERT theories and solving illustrative examples. Month two is dedicated to chapter-wise previous years' question papers (PYQs) to understand recurring exam patterns. Month three must be strictly reserved for timed computer-based test (CBT) mock simulations to build endurance for the 3-hour continuous assessment.

Step-by-Step Practical Decision Framework
Actionable steps to evaluate institutions before applying
1Step 1
Syllabus Audit & Resource Assembly
Download the official COMEDK information brochure, map out Class 11 and 12 weightages, and gather standard reference books like NCERT and DC Pandey.
2Step 2
Daily Speed & Accuracy Drills
Allocate 60 minutes per subject daily. Since you have 1 minute per question on average, practice short-cut calculations and mental math to boost throughput.
3Step 3
Mock Analysis & Error Correction
Take at least 15 full-length online mock tests during the final month. Maintain an error log to review skipped or incorrect questions systematically.

Frequently Asked Questions
Clear answers to common student admission questions
Is coaching mandatory to get a sub-1000 rank in COMEDK?
No, thousands of aspirants crack COMEDK with top ranks every year using self-study. Consistent practice of previous years' question papers and disciplined time management are far more effective than coaching classes.
What are the best books for self-studying COMEDK Physics and Mathematics?
For Physics, NCERT textbooks paired with HC Verma or DC Pandey provide excellent conceptual clarity. For Mathematics, standard NCERT textbooks along with RD Sharma objective guides cover the required problem-solving variety.
How is the time limit managed during the COMEDK exam?
Since the exam consists of 180 questions in 180 minutes with no negative marking, candidates should attempt straightforward theoretical questions first, leaving complex numerical problems for a second pass.
Does COMEDK require Chemistry as a mandatory subject?
Under updated eligibility guidelines, Chemistry is no longer strictly compulsory as the fourth subject, allowing flexibility based on the candidate's chosen academic stream and interest.
